Researchers have developed a new method for detecting AI-generated videos by analyzing noise patterns within bit-planes. This "Noise Amplification" technique enhances subtle image and temporal details that current text-to-video models struggle to replicate. The approach involves extracting and amplifying noise signals before feeding them into discriminator networks for classification. A new benchmark dataset, HardGVD, was also introduced to evaluate detection methods in challenging scenarios. AI
IMPACT This research could lead to more robust detection of AI-generated video content, addressing a growing concern with the proliferation of synthetic media.
